Henry Havelock
- Favourite Briton.

Born in Sunderland, Tyne and Wear
Born on 5th of April 1795
Died on 29th of November 1857

Born 1795. Died 1857 - English soldier.

Entered the army and was sent to India in 1823. Distinguished himself in the Afghan Sikh Wars. Took part in the Indian Mutiny (1857-58) when he defeated the rebels at Fatehpur and recaptured Cawnpore. Besieged by a second group of rebels they were rescued by Colin Campbell; Havelock died four days later of dysentery.
